We are seeking a Sr. HCM Systems Analyst to help integrate, automate, and optimize our human capital management systems. The role supports HRIS, ATS, benefits, and other connected tools while ensuring data integrity, security, and compliance.
What You’ll Do- Own and continuously improve HCM systems, including HRIS, ATS, benefit platforms, and comp tools.
- Partner with the internal Tech team to design, build, and maintain integrations and file feeds.
- Drive automation and AI initiatives to streamline processes.
- Ensure HCM data is clean, well‑structured, and configured to power reliable reporting, automation, and integrations.
- Build and maintain reports and dashboards that help leadership and teammates make informed decisions.
- Manage system security to ensure appropriate access and data protection.
- Own compliance filings (e.g., EEOC, 5500s) and maintain the employee handbook.
- Collaborate with teammates across HCM, recruiting, finance and other departments to translate needs into system solutions.
- Document systems and processes so knowledge is accessible to the whole team.
- 5+ years of HCM systems experience across multiple platforms, including integrations, implementations, or migrations preferably at a small or mid‑size company.
- A hands‑on problem solver who loves to build.
- Experience gathering business requirements and translating them into system configuration and process design.
- Strong data skills, understanding how data must be structured upstream to be useful downstream.
- Comfort working with technical tools; experience with BI platforms (Sigma, Power BI, Tableau) and a general understanding of APIs is a plus.
- Equally comfortable discussing HCM and Tech, able to bridge the two as a true partner.
- Preference for candidates located in Chicago (relocation assistance available).
Salary Range: $110,000—$140,000 USD. The role also includes an annual discretionary bonus based on individual performance and firm results.
